A new Love’s Travel Stop housing a Hardee’s restaurant is currently under construction just north of Casper, Wyoming, and is expected to open this fall. The 11,000 square foot truck stop, gas station, and convenience store will be located just off Interstate 25 near Bar Nunn.
Facility Details
The new facility will be large enough to accommodate professional drivers, casual customers, and RVers, offering RV hookups and showers along with large bathrooms and a variety of food and snack options. The location is expected to employ between 40 to 50 people.
When the location opens, Love’s will donate $5,000 to a local nonprofit and have an annual donation budget moving forward. The location will also donate $5,000 to the Children’s Miracle Network hospital that serves the area.
The new Hardee’s will mark the return of the fast food burger chain to Casper, which saw both of its locations close without warning in July 2023, shortly after its franchisee went bankrupt.
